Several years ago, I started to brine my Thanksgiving turkey, and I continue to do it today. There are two differences between brining and marinating. The first is the base. For brining, you need a salt base. For a marinade, you need an acidic base like vinegar. The second difference is the amount of time

Commonly showcased side by side, nectarines, and peaches are very similar. What is the difference between these two stone fruits that look and taste comparable to each other? The two main differences between nectarines and peaches are the skin and size. Nectarines are smooth-skinned, and peaches are covered with fuzzy skin. This is perfect for people who do not like the fuzzy texture. The nectarine is also visibly smaller than the peach. In addition, nectarines are firmer, sweeter, and juicier
It’s important to know the best place to store fruits and vegetables and also which foods to keep separate from each other. Some fruits give off ethylene gas, which can speed the ripening process of some other produce. Apples, avocados, bananas, kiwi, peaches, pears, and tomatoes are a few of the top ethylene producing produce, and cucumbers, grapes, leafy greens, and peppers are the most sensitive to ethylene gas. Munched by cookie lovers, the oatmeal cookie has enjoyed popularity. America has even designated April 30th as National Oatmeal Cookie Day! Oatmeal raisin cookies may have evolved from oat cake the Scottish and British soldiers carried with them during times of war. Soldiers carried the oat cakes because eating them would give bursts of energy for a battle.
